NBA Explores European Expansion: Real Madrid and Top Clubs in Talks for New League Partnership

NBA Commissioner Adam Silver recently held discussions with Real Madrid officials in Paris regarding a potential partnership for the NBA's upcoming European league. Real Madrid, a prominent EuroLeague team, is considering joining the new league, which could lead other top clubs to follow suit. Silver also met with representatives from private equity firms and Galatasaray in London, exploring various partnership opportunities in Europe.

In addition to Real Madrid, the NBA is in talks with other European teams like Alba Berlin about potential collaboration in the new league. The league is looking to expand its international presence by partnering with top clubs in Europe. Real Madrid, Barcelona, ASVEL Basket, and Fenerbahce are among the key teams being closely watched for their potential involvement in the NBA's European venture.
